Fallout: New California
In development for five years, this New Vegas mod arrives in October, and it's an ambitious-sounding creation. New California will feature 16,000 lines of voiced dialogue (which seems of a pretty high quality based on the above teaser) and 12 endings, inspired by the more open-ended Black Isle Fallout games, to which New Vegas was their most obvious successor. The team is working on adding side quests before launch, too, but even without those, a big chunk of new Fallout story suits us just fine.

Fallout Miami
Hot damn that is a cool teaser. Clearly you've already got lovely snapshots of beaches in Fallout Miami, but the world will apparently also feature casinos, retirement homes and a golf course that's become an irradiated jungle. The creators of this Fallout 4 mod have also conceived of three entirely new factions to occupy the world, each of which have their own background lore already. Expect new weapons alongside this change of setting, too. I'm mostly just excited about the idea of exploring a seaside holiday destination through the prism of new Fallout.

Fallout: Cascadia
Hot damn, what is it about empty images of Fallout landscapes and old-ass music? Cascadia's trailer is impressive and kind of moving. This Fallout 4 mod is set in Seattle, a setting that's been reclaimed somewhat by nature—a deliberate touch to reflect it being set several decades after Fallout 4. 'We wanted to create a world where nature shows subtle signs of having returned to a more natural order,' said Dr Weird, the project's director of implementation, in a conversation with Kotaku. It promises to 'revisit old gameplay systems from previous instalments of the Fallout franchise such as skills, the dialogue system and much more'.

Fallout: Atlanta
Atlanta, best known to me as a city that sank in an episode of Futurama, the place where The Walking Dead is filmed and as a gigantic airport where I got lost twice, is the subject of this New Vegas mod. Once again it's an entirely new landmass for the game with its own story. It's currently in alpha, having been in the works since 2016. It promises new interiors, a new casino, new quests and most importantly, 'a new vibe that will be different to new Vegas or any other fallout game'.

Fallout 4: New Vegas
The pitch here is nice and straightforward: recreating Fallout: New Vegas in Fallout 4's Creation Engine. As you can see from the environmental comparison above, it's a flattering transition for Obsidian's game, which is often called the best 3D Fallout. I'm not prepared to commit to an opinion on that here, but know that I love them all. Don't expect the team to add anything new to the game. 'If it's in the base game, we'll be striving to add it to the mod,' says their FAQ page. 'If it isn't, probably not.'

Fallout: The Frontier
We've been covering this New Vegas mod since all the way back in 2016. While its creators call it more of an expansion in the vein of those released for New Vegas like Old World Blues, or a 'super DLC', it's already 19GB and growing. It's set in a large, snowy version of Portland, and will feature new assets for buildings, armour and weapons, as well as frost effects. You'll also encounter familiar factions like the NCR, Legion and the Scavengers, with the Enclave also making an appearance. As of now, it's around 80% complete, and the teaser above was released about a month ago.

Craftable Ammunition
: Fallout 4's wasteland is filled with workbenches where you can customize weapons and craft items. But you would think with that with all the random junk you find throughout the game you'd be able to craft ammo too. Thankfully, this patch lets you craft any kind of ammo you want, as long as you've reached the required Gun Nut, Demolition, and Science perk levels.

Creature Follower
: Have you ever wished you could have one of the wasteland's various creatures join you on your adventures as a companion? This mod lets you do just that, giving you the ability to issue commands to them like a normal companion NPC, with the exception of the relationship option. Compatible companion creatures include: a Deathclaw, a Yao Guai, a Gen 1 Synth, a Gen 2 Synth, a Mutant Hound, a Super Mutant Behemoth, a Raider Dog, a Gorilla, a Radscorpion, a Vicious Dog, or a Cat.

More Armor Slots
: This mod lets you utilize all five armor slots on any of the outfits that typically take up all slots, like tuxedos, dresses, and clean suits. It's an ideal mod to have for those who want the extra added stat boosts of armor pieces on top of a special outfit with strong statistics. However, it's worth noting that since the armor parts weren't designed to be layered on to certain outfits, there is a significant amount of clipping.

Fallout 4 Configuration Tool
: The Configuration Tool lets you unlock tweaks and options not readily accessible through the game's launcher and setting menu. For example, you can unlock the frame rate, change the color of the UI, expand the game's field of view, adjust mouse sensitivity, customize lighting and shadows, and much more. This mod is a must for players who love to customize and tailor the game's settings at the most granular level.

Texture Optimization
: The framerate of Fallout 4 can take some major dips at times, especially in the game's larger areas or grand combat situations. Thankfully, the Texture Optimization mod reduces this problem without sacrificing visual fidelity by replacing higher texture files with smaller ones, improving performance all around.
